Burnt trees line the Bruthen-Buchan Road, south of Buchan, Victoria. Over 30 million acres burned during Australia’s 2019-2020 summer of hell. That’s 12 times the recent Amazon fires and more extensive than ever before in recorded history. Leica has officially stopped production of the CCD image sensor inside the Leica M9 series of cameras. As a result “defective sensors cannot be replaced” moving forward, and you’ll need to upgrade to an M10 or another Leica camera if this happens to you. Split double exposures can be a lot of fun. They essentially involve covering half of the frame and taking a shot and then covering the other half of the frame and taking another – both shots contributing to a single exposure.
